The Ingredients of a Good Plot

1. Dynamic Characters: Engaging plots in builder games often feature characters with unique personalities and stories, adding depth and emotion to the gameplay.

2. Compelling Objectives: A well-crafted plot provides intriguing quests that captivate you and keep the momentum going as you play.

3. Unexpected Twists: Who doesn’t love a good plot twist? Engaging plots in builder games are full of surprises that keep players on their toes.

4. Rich Backstory: The best plots come with a detailed world history, making every element of the game feel purposeful and connected.

5. Player Agency: Giving players the power to make decisions influences the plot’s progression, creating a personalized gaming experience.

Crafting a Narrative

Ever wondered how developers create such engaging plots in builder games? Well, it’s no small feat. First, they design a world that’s ripe for exploration and creativity. This foundation is crucial because, without an interesting setting, the plot has nowhere to grow. From there, they weave in layers of storylines and quests that make every game session exciting and unpredictable.

The next step involves crafting compelling characters you want to root for—or even against! These characters provide the emotional anchor that makes the plot resonate with players. They offer unique perspectives and challenges, often bringing their own mini-stories into the broader narrative. This makes the plot richly layered and multifaceted, inviting players to explore and engage on multiple levels.
